The community is invited to enjoy performances by some up and coming musicians and speech artists on Sunday, April 14.
The 2024 Cariboo Festival is wrapping up after more than 70 participants took part in this year’s festival with two events at St. Andrew’s United Church at 1000 Huckvale Place.
At 2 p.m. on April 14, Spotlight on Performance will highlight some of the vocal/choral, piano and speech arts performers who stood out to adjudicators and the audience.
Those performers who achieved gold in the festival will then take the stage at 3:30 p.m. for the Honours Concert, featuring those achieving gold from each category.
To achieve gold, adjudicators had to score the performers with an 85 per cent or higher rating.
Come support the young musicians and performers in the community. A Cariboo Festival Society annual general meeting is to follow the performances.
Entry is by donation at the door and open to all.
